haha, marti! as ian said, it was intense and moving (very! at least, for me). i donīt think it was anything special but the energy of each song and the twits and turns on the regular ones was magical. probably it was only me, but i do believe people there could agree.

he looked very tired, his eye were shouting "bed" when he came out on stage and his voice sounded a bit rusty when he spoke ("wow" he said by looking at people and mentioned how great the festival was at the very beginning), but when he started playing... all disappeared.

again, there were no surprises on the set list, i luckily can say that iīve listened to the same songs live more than a few times now but they caught me very single time all over again. he was not really chatty, i think he only told the story of sperm before the professor and a few words to guide us through volcano chorus... and at the very end when he dismissed a few songs due to lack of time, but he looked very happy (maybe happy is not the right word, but i believe you can get the gist) and in a good mood.

actually, it seemed he would play cheers darling at some point, because the table was set: two wine glasses, three (!!!) bottle of wine and two chairs, but it didnīt happen. he said "cheers darling, no, because itīs too long"... he played tbd in the end.
